Opened 6 months ago

Closed 6 months ago

#18720 closed enhancement (fixed)

libjpeg-turbo-3.0.1

Reported by: Bruce Dubbs Owned by: Bruce Dubbs
Priority: normal Milestone: 12.1
Component: BOOK Version: git
Severity: normal Keywords:
Cc:

Description

New point version.

Change History (3)

comment:1 by Xi Ruoyao, 6 months ago

  1. The x86-64 SIMD functions now use a standard stack frame, prologue, and epilogue so that debuggers and profilers can reliably capture backtraces from within the functions.
  1. Fixed two minor issues in the interblock smoothing algorithm that caused mathematical (but not necessarily perceptible) edge block errors when decompressing progressive JPEG images exactly two MCU blocks in width or that use vertical chrominance subsampling.
  1. Fixed a regression introduced by 3.0 beta2 that, in rare cases, caused the C Huffman encoder (which is not used by default on x86 and Arm CPUs) to generate incorrect results if the Neon SIMD extensions were explicitly disabled at build time (by setting the WITH_SIMD CMake variable to 0) in an AArch64 build of libjpeg-turbo.

comment:2 by Bruce Dubbs, 6 months ago

Owner: changed from blfs-book to Bruce Dubbs
Status: newassigned

comment:3 by Bruce Dubbs, 6 months ago

Resolution: fixed
Status: assignedclosed

Fixed at commits

46f3c6610c Update to xfce4-terminal-1.1.1.
161212753c Update to libjpeg-turbo-3.0.1.
9b1d3dd975 Update to qpdf-11.6.3.
2658a0d7e7 Update to enchant-2.6.1.
bb79f7c314 Update to libblockdev-3.0.4.
Note: See TracTickets for help on using tickets.